AI-extracted from the 10-Q filed 2026-08-07 — Q2 FY2026 (six months ended June 30, 2026). Every figure is machine-verified against the filing text on SEC EDGAR.
Exzeo's revenue grew 4.4% to $113.3M in H1 2026, with net income rising 10.3% to $43.7M, though customer concentration remains elevated at 86.9% from two related-party customers.
Growth from two new customers onboarded late 2025 and existing customer base expansion, offset by modestly lower fee rates reflecting service mix changes.
Lower catastrophe-related claim activity and reduced litigation costs as prior storm events (Hurricane Ian, Milton, Helene) progressed toward resolution.
